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Adantic White-Sided Dolphin | floating crystalwort |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Marchantiophyta (liverwort)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Marchantiopsida (Marchantiopsida) |
| Order | Cetacea (Whales & Dolphins) | Marchantiales (Marchantiales) |
| Family | Delphinidae (Oceanic Dolphins) | Ricciaceae |
| Genus | Lagenorhynchus | Riccia |
| Species | Lagenorhynchus acutus | Riccia fluitans |
